In this "riveting account of the future," America has ceded the
heavens to the tyrants and the renegades—from the six-time Hugo
Award–winning author ( Wall Street Journal). The US has abandoned
its quest for the stars, and an old enemy has moved in to fill the
void. The potential wealth of the universe is now in malevolent hands.
Rebel billionaire Dan Randolph—possessor of the largest
privately-owned company in space—intends to weaken the stranglehold
the new despotic masters of the solar system have on the lucrative ore
industry. But when the mineral-rich asteroid he sets in orbit around
the Earth is commandeered by the enemy, and his unarmed workers are
slaughtered in cold blood, the course of Randolph's life is changed
forever. Now cataclysm is aimed at the exposed heart of America—a
potential catastrophe that Randolph himself inadvertently set in
motion. And the maverick entrepreneur must use his skills, cunning,
and vast resources to strike out at his foes hard, fast and with
ruthless precision—and wear proudly the mantle that fate thrust upon
him: space pirate! "Swashbuckling action, a likeable—if
macho—hero, and a down-to-the-wire plot." — Library Journal "A
solid, well-plotted tale that maintains a pleasing balance and tension
between the politicking, the romancing, and the action-adventure. One
of Bova's best." — Kirkus Reviews
